  1. How much does 1 and a 1 ⁄ 2 ounces weigh in grams? 1.5 oz to g conversion. 150% of a ounce ≈ 42.5 grams. An ounce is a unit of weight equal to 1/16 th of a pound or about 28.35 grams. A gram is a unit of weight equal to 1/1000 th of a kilogram.

  5. 2 kwi 2020 · You can look up the conversion for 1 cup of all-purpose flour in the chart, which is 125 g. Then, you can divide that by 16 to get the conversion for 1 tablespoon, which is approximately 8 g. Another helpful feature of the chart is the breakdown of measurements for 1/2, 1/3, and 1/4 cups, tablespoons, and teaspoons.
